#4ca257 hex color

In a RGB color space, hex #4ca257 is composed of 29.8% red, 63.5% green and 34.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 46.3% yellow and 36.5% black. It has a hue angle of 127.7 degrees, a saturation of 36.1% and a lightness of 46.7%. #4ca257 color hex could be obtained by blending #98ffae with #004500.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010201 is the darkest color, while #f3faf4 is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#717d72 is the less saturated color, while #03eb21 is the most saturated one.
